Some features of the transport processes of ion-implanted boron under conditions of transient enhanced diffusion suppression

Abstract

It has been shown that during thermal treatments of silicon layers preamorphized by germanium implantation and then implanted with boron ions the transport of impurity atoms occurs right up to a temperature of 850C due to migration of the nonequilibrium boron interstitials.
